Default RSD gauge relocator...

I Have a 2011 Nightster....I wanna throw on this RSD gauge relocator that dropps the gauge down a bit flatter, and allows you to remove the eyelid over the headlight. My question is....will I be able to read the gauge and the LED indicators with 3" risers? Seems like the bar will be in the way.... Anyone have a clue? Thanx

I've got the RSD gauge relocator with the led light display, I didn't put clip ons on the bike though, I've got t-bars, so I can pretty much see the gauge through them. Pics enclosed. It's probably just going to depend on how much of it you want to see and what risers you put on. Here's are pics from sitting on the bike. I can see the dummy lights and my speed without any problems.
